    Amsoil now offers multiple SAPS (sulfated ash,...

    Amsoil now offers multiple SAPS (sulfated ash, phosphorus and sulfur) formulations for their European car oils. The AFLQT Mid-SAPS is the correct formula to match the VW 505.01 spec for the RS6. ...
